    Headquarters, 2d Infantry Division, General Orders No. 292 (July 13, 1951)

    The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ress July 9, 1918, takes pleasure in presenting the Silver Star to Corporal [then Private] Harold E. Reid (ASN: US-55030389), United States Army, for gallantry in action as a member of Company L, 38th Infantry Regiment, 2d Infantry Division, in action against an armed enemy on 15 March 1951, in the vicinity of Ami-dong, Korea. When his platoon was pinned down by heavy enemy machine gun fire during an attack, Corporal Reid, with complete disregard for his own safety, boldly charged the enemy machine gun position with hand grenades, destroying it and permitting the platoon to advance. His heroic action prevented many casualties among his comrades in the platoon. The gallantry displayed by Corporal Reid reflects great credit upon himself and upholds the highest traditions of the Military Service of the United States.
